summaryrefslogtreecommitdiff
path: root/qapi
diff options
context:
space:
mode:
authorAlberto Garcia <berto@igalia.com>2015-04-08 12:29:20 +0300
committerKevin Wolf <kwolf@redhat.com>2015-04-28 15:36:09 +0200
commitdc881b441d74b8fc6c9c007cd03d5d05bca388dd (patch)
treee5dc89e46ec6b1817806115ff36bc50ebe7a108d /qapi
parent81e5f78a9f4f13548ec1edddaf780d339f18e2d2 (diff)
downloadqemu-dc881b441d74b8fc6c9c007cd03d5d05bca388dd.tar.gz
qemu-dc881b441d74b8fc6c9c007cd03d5d05bca388dd.tar.bz2
qemu-dc881b441d74b8fc6c9c007cd03d5d05bca388dd.zip
block: add 'node-name' field to BLOCK_IMAGE_CORRUPTED
Since this event can occur in nodes that cannot have a device name associated, include also a field with the node name. Signed-off-by: Alberto Garcia <berto@igalia.com> Reviewed-by: Eric Blake <eblake@redhat.com> Reviewed-by: Max Reitz <mreitz@redhat.com> Message-id: 147cec5b3594f4bec0cb41c98afe5fcbfb67567c.1428485266.git.berto@igalia.com Signed-off-by: Stefan Hajnoczi <stefanha@redhat.com> Signed-off-by: Kevin Wolf <kwolf@redhat.com>
Diffstat (limited to 'qapi')
-rw-r--r--qapi/block-core.json17
1 files changed, 11 insertions, 6 deletions
diff --git a/qapi/block-core.json b/qapi/block-core.json
index e158a7cfc2..82a8ae5f0a 100644
--- a/qapi/block-core.json
+++ b/qapi/block-core.json
@@ -1757,7 +1757,11 @@
#
# Emitted when a corruption has been detected in a disk image
#
-# @device: device name
+# @device: device name. This is always present for compatibility
+# reasons, but it can be empty ("") if the image does not
+# have a device name associated.
+#
+# @node-name: #optional node name (Since: 2.4)
#
# @msg: informative message for human consumption, such as the kind of
# corruption being detected. It should not be parsed by machine as it is
@@ -1776,11 +1780,12 @@
# Since: 1.7
##
{ 'event': 'BLOCK_IMAGE_CORRUPTED',
- 'data': { 'device' : 'str',
- 'msg' : 'str',
- '*offset': 'int',
- '*size' : 'int',
- 'fatal' : 'bool' } }
+ 'data': { 'device' : 'str',
+ '*node-name' : 'str',
+ 'msg' : 'str',
+ '*offset' : 'int',
+ '*size' : 'int',
+ 'fatal' : 'bool' } }
##
# @BLOCK_IO_ERROR